| 中文摘要: |
| 本研究基于生态系统理论构建了科普生态系统,解构了构成要素和结构关系并描述了科普生态系
统在供给端、需求端、环境端和展现端的特征。在此基础上,设计了“4W2E”科普发展评价框架,从人
员、内容、渠道、受众、环境、影响六个维度提出了由29个测量指标构成的评价指标体系。采用AHP与
熵值法—Critic组合赋权法,利用多源数据集,对2012—2021年全国31个省域的科普发展指数进行了测
算。结果表明,全国科普发展整体呈现阶段性上升态势,东部地区科普发展水平较高,中西部地区相对滞
后。从空间分布上看,科普发展水平呈现由东向西逐步降低的态势,地区间差距仍较为明显。2015—2018
年,科普发展水平出现略微下降,主要受科普内容供给不足影响导致。建议后发地区要充分利用科普水平
较高地区的空间溢出效应,通过经济和教育的反哺,带动科普资源的合理分布;充分利用互联网、大数据
和人工智能等新技术,拓宽科普渠道构建高效的科普信息化体系。 |
| 英文摘要: |
| Grounded in ecosystem theory,this study constructs a science popularization ecosystem and
deconstructs its key elements and structural relationships. Six key components were identified across four
dimensions: supply-side,demand-side,environment-side,and presentation-side. Following six key
components,a“4W2E”evaluation framework was developed with 29 measurement indicators across
six dimensions: persons,contents,channels,audience,environment,and impact. Utilizing multi
source datasets,the science popularization development index was calculated for 31 provincial-level
regions from 2012 to 2021 using a combined Analytic Hierarchy Process(AHP)and Entropy-Critic
weighting method. The findings identify a phase-wise upward trend in nationwide science popularization
development,with eastern regions demonstrating higher development levels than the central and
western regions. Spatially,the development of science popularization shows a progressive expansion
from east to west,accompanied by notable regional disparities. During the 2015—2018 period,
science popularization development exhibited a marginal decline,primarily attributable to insufficient
supply-side content provision. These findings provide empirically grounded policy recommendations for
optimizing resource allocation and promoting quality-intensive science popularization public strategies. |
